Alta Spine receives FDA clearance for cervical spine plating system — 3 insights

Alta Spine recently gained FDA 510 (k) clearance for its V3 guided segmental cervical plating system for anterior cervical discectomy and fusion.

Advertisement

Three insights:

1. The V3 system was developed to compliment the company’s HiJAK AC — an expandable cervical interbody — that was launched in March.

2. The device promotes the use of less invasive, individual plates for multi-level constructs, decreasing the dissection and retraction required to perform an ACDF.

3. The V3 system, combined with HiJAK — which offers adjustable lordosis up to 20 degrees — enables surgeons to address each diseased segment individually.
